Crisp hardcover.; First Edition, First Printing of the first English translation of Vargas Llosa's writing, his first novel. "Moving back and forth from pst to present, from inner thought to outer action, from inside the [Leoncio Prado Military] Academy to the city outside, Vargas Llosa exposes the sordid world of the military elite, with its hypocrisy, moral decay, and power politics, and the corruption throughout the society beyond the Academy walls." Small wonder that a thousand copies of his novel were burned in official ceremony at the actual Academy in Lima, an early sign of the impact of the Peruvian novelist that earned the 2010 Nobel Prize for Literature. ; 409 pages 1st English Language Edition; First Printing.
